Attending To Water Filling Problems
Water filling up problems in laundry appliances most typically originate from a malfunction within either the water inlet shutoff or the stress switch. The shutoff controls the quantity of water supplied to the device, while the stress switch informs the device when it has actually reached the appropriate degree. If the valve is harmed or the pressure switch is defective, it can result in wrong water levels; either filling up way too much or insufficient.

One approach of fixing entails manually loading the device with water. If the device operates usually when manually filled up, the issue likely lies within the water inlet shutoff. Additionally, if an extreme quantity of water goes into the maker despite getting to the set level, the pressure button is most likely the culprit. It is important for house owners to follow the certain instructions and security preventative measures offered by the producer when examining these components, or consider enlisting the aid of a specialist.

Addressing Water Drainage Issues
When a washing maker experiences drain problems, one usual indicator is water remaining inside the home appliance even after a clean cycle finishes. This problem can be caused by various aspects such as a blocked or kinked drain tube, or a malfunctioning drain pump. Being aware of these regular reasons is critical for determining and fixing the underlying problem effectively. If water remains to collect in spite of multiple rinse efforts, it is important to act promptly to stop water damages or the growth of mold and mildew.

Embracing a systematic strategy to attend to drainage disturbances can produce acceptable outcomes. First of all, a visual examination of the drain hose can expose possible obstructions or physical damages. If removing the clog or straightening out a curved hose does not give a resolution, it might be time to take into consideration a malfunctioning drain pump, which might require expert servicing or substitute. Additionally, mindfully monitoring any type of mistake code that shows up on the appliance's console during the cycle can provide useful insights relating to the nature of the interruption. An appliance handbook can assist in decoding these mistake messages, even more aiding in determining the exact concern.

Repairing Non-Spinning Problems
Among the typical concerns you could confront with your washing appliance is a non-spinning drum. This is usually a symptom of a mechanical failure, generally with the motor, belts, or lid button. The electric motor is what powers your washing machine's spin cycle, and if it's worn out or malfunctioning, your washing machine won't rotate. Similarly, malfunctioning belts and lid buttons can prevent the drum's capability to turn.

Identifying the exact reason for the non-spinning concern can occasionally be tough yet is an essential action in the direction of an efficient fixing. To identify the issue, initially inspect the cover button for indications of wear or damage. A fast approach of confirmation can be paying attention for a clicking noise as you open and close the lid. In the absence of this noise, the cover button might require replacement. Broken belts or stressed out electric motors may call for experienced inspection. Always bear in mind, security initially; before examining any electric or mechanical component, always make sure that the washing machine is unplugged.

Managing Laundry Cycle Disruptions
Laundry appliance concerns can extend past plain water loading or draining problems. Insufficient cycles, where the maker stops unexpectedly throughout wash, rinse, or rotate cycles, can be specifically vexing. This trouble can originate from various sources, including malfunctioning timers or control panel, malfunctioning lid buttons, overheating motors, or malfunctioning water level buttons. Addressing these underlying causes is essential to recovering the device's typical cycle.

To resolve this issue, it is essential to very carefully diagnose the trouble and determine its underlying cause. Begin by checking out the lid button to see if it is worn and no more working properly. Next off, examine the water level switch for any issues that could bring about inaccurate signals being sent to the maker. It is also vital to examine the control panel and timer of the appliance as any mistakes in these parts might cause the device quiting mid-cycle or failing to start. It is important to come close to troubleshooting with care as a result of the involvement of electrical power, and if you are unclear about any type of action, it is best to seek aid from a qualified expert.

Solving Excessive Noise and Resonance Troubles
If your laundry maker is generating too much sound and resonance, maybe an indication of different troubles such as an unbalanced lots or a faulty component in the home appliance. Vibrations typically happen when clothes are not uniformly spread out in the drum, yet this can be taken care of by quiting the cycle and rearranging the tons. Nonetheless, if the noise and resonance proceed, it might be brought on by worn-out or loosened drive belts, drum bearings, or electric motor elements.

To detect properly, an individual may need to manually inspect the discussed components for any type of indications of wear or damages and replace any kind of malfunctioning aspects promptly. If your home appliance is constantly making loud noises, regardless of your attempts at tons redistribution, it's highly suggested to consult an expert. A qualified service technician will certainly have the skills and expertise to identify and remedy the origin of the issue, guaranteeing your equipment runs efficiently and quietly. It's vital to deal with these concerns without delay, as extended vibrations or sounds may cause further damage to your device or environments.
